  • Racking tests of sound insulated clt wall elements with angle bracket connections [Elektronski vir]
    Azinović, Boris ; Kržan, Meta ; Pazlar, Tomaž
    In the paper, the results of an experimental campaign on 13 full size sound insulated CLT wall specimens with insulated steel-angle brackets as connections are presented. The aim of the study was to ... analyse the seismic behaviour of the system and additionally to study the influence of sound insulation bedding under the wall on the seismic response. Elastomer bedding is already in use in construction of timber buildings as sound insulation; it is, however, due to its unknown influence on the seismic behaviour of the system limited to non-seismic areas. A comparison of the lateral load-bearing capacity, displacement capacity, ductility and stiffness obtained in racking tests for uninsulated specimens and specimens with four types of insulation bedding is presented. Furthermore, the level of vertical load, position of angle brackets and the loading protocol in terms of rate were varied for some tests. The results show that the elastomer bedding does not influence the load-bearing capacity of the wall system but reduces its stiffness and therefore increases its displacement capacity.
